Advances in graph neural networks for alloy design and properties predictions: a review

Figure 7. (A) ALIGNN architecture, which augments the atom-level graph with a line graph so that bond and bond-angle information is captured through coupled message-passing updates of atoms, bonds, and angles; (B) Efficiency-optimized graph neural model developed by Dong, featuring radial-basis edge encodings and adaptive interaction blocks that accelerate training while preserving accuracy. (A) reproduced from Ref.[48], copyright © 2021. (B) reproduced with permission from Ref.[49], copyright © 2023 American Chemical Society. ALIGNN: Atomistic line graph neural network.
